CB Richard Ellis Corporate Profile

CB Richard Ellis is the world's largest commercial real estate services company with operations in more than 30 countries. The company leases, sells, operates and appraises commercial properties; manages real estate investment portfolios; supervises construction; and originates and brokers mortgages. In all, it manages more than 1 billion square feet of commercial space.

Founded in 1906, CBRE is known as the industry's top dealmaker. Even in this economic downturn, it has recently brokered a lease expansion in New York for Viacom, and relocated Taco Bell's headquarters to Irvine, Calif.

Last year, CB Richard Ellis represented owner MetLife Inc. when it transacted the largest sale ever of a single piece of real estate: Manhattan's Stuyvesant Town apartments to Tishman Speyer Properties for $5.4 billion.

The company has made dozens of acquisitions since it began to diversify in 1991. One of its most recent acquisitions include the $2.2 billion purchase of Dallas-based real estate services firm Trammell Crow Co. last year.
